bapi para material configurable
El mensaje de error "El sistema no acepta la introducción de un área funcional" (FH599) generalmente indica un problema con la configuración del área funcional en el sistema. Puede verificar la configuración del área funcional en la transacción OB45 y asegurarse de que esté configurada correctamente para su organización.
Sin embargo, en relación a la creación del material configurable en el pedido de ventas a través de la BAPI_SALESORDER_CREATEFROMDAT2, puede intentar lo siguiente:
1. Asegúrese de que los datos que está pasando a la BAPI sean correctos y estén completos. Asegúrese de haber proporcionado todos los datos necesarios para el material configurable, como los valores de configuración y los componentes.
2. Utilice la función BAPI_MATERIAL_AVAILABILITY para verificar la disponibilidad de los componentes y los valores de configuración del material configurable antes de crear el pedido de ventas. Si alguno de los componentes o valores de configuración no está disponible, la BAPI_SALESORDER_CREATEFROMDAT2 devolverá un error.
3. Verifique si ha configurado correctamente el conjunto de variantes en el material configurable.
4. Verifique si ha configurado correctamente los requisitos previos para el material configurable.
5. Intente utilizar la BAPI_MATERIAL_SAVEDATA para guardar los datos del material configurable antes de crear el pedido de ventas con la BAPI_SALESORDER_CREATEFROMDAT2.
Espero que esto ayude a resolver su problema.